Pie Gourmet
This beloved Vienna staple is known for its rich, buttery crusts and classic fillings. Choose from holiday favorites like pecan bourbon or sweet potato, or savory flavors like chicken pot pie and veggie pot pie. All orders must be placed by November 18. 507 Maple Ave. W, Vienna

Acme Pie Co.
Acme serves up handmade, hearty pies with a dash of attitude. Choose from six delectable flavors: apple, apple cranberry, mixed berry, pecan chocolate maple, pumpkin with candied ginger and sweet potato. Every pie boasts a perfectly flaky crust. 2803 Columbia Pike, Arlington
